Basic Overview
FTP is an acronym for File Transfer Protocol and is used to transfer files between 2 connected computers. You can use FTP to exchange files between computer accounts, transfer files between an account and a desktop computer, or access online software archives. The easiest method for uploading files to your website is to use an FTP Client.

The first thing you need, is a FTP client. A popular (and free) FTP client is called FileZilla.

1. Download FileZilla: http://filezilla-project.org/download.php?type=client (available for both Windows & Mac)

2. Install FileZilla.

3. Run FileZilla.

4. In the "Host" field, enter your domain name.

5. In the "Username" field, enter your cpanel username (or FTP username if you've created more than one FTP account).

6. In the "Password" field, enter your cpanel password (or FTP password if you've created more than one FTP account).

7. Leave port set at "21" or if you leave it blank this will be default.

8. Click "Quick Connect"

The LEFT side shows the files on YOUR PC. The RIGHT side shows the file on your server. Double-click the "public_html/" folder on the RIGHT hand side. This is the "root" of your website. All you need do now, is find the files you want to upload on the LEFT side of the screen and drag them to the RIGHT side. This will upload the files to your website.
